I was so thoroughly invested in the Max stuff this season. Her arc is my favorite thing the show has done yet because it holds so much thematic weight on its own as a symbol of fighting depression. A lot of people picked up on this with the famous Kate Bush scene. And it's resonated with me a ton. I was gutted when she "died" (and major kudos to Caleb for that performance...he and Gaten showed up). But while her death would have been bold from a story telling perspective, it would have ruined my day from a character perspective. The conflict they showed all season with her character being cursed, escaping death, and then welcoming it again in the final episode would have made her death so downbeat if we're taking her story and Vecna's curse as a symbol of fighting depression/guilt. Honestly, the fact that after all of that we see her bones snap and eyes bleed still feels like a bold storytelling move. I was really moved by Eleven's moment with her. "You're not going" was the perfect answer to everything Max said about wanting to die. And it also felt like a nice companion moment to Max saying "I'm still here" at the end of EP 4. If she was suddenly okay, that would be a copout. But clearly she's not. But she's still alive, miraculously, which I think is beautiful. Basically, I think everything involving Max was perfect this season and Sadie Sink's performance was incredible.
